Cellular Results



The cellular impacts of cold laser treatment materialize with increased energy manufacturing and improved cellular repair work devices. When the cold laser light permeates the skin and reaches the targeted tissues, it boosts the mitochondria, the powerhouse of the cell, to produce more adenosine triphosphate (ATP).

This increase in ATP provides cells with the energy they require to perform various features, such as repairing damage and lowering swelling.

Moreover, cold laser therapy activates a cascade of biochemical reactions within the cells that promote recovery and regrowth. By improving mobile repair work devices, the treatment speeds up tissue recuperation and reduces recovery time from injuries or particular problems.


This procedure additionally aids to raise blood flow to the treated location, generating even more oxygen and nutrients crucial for cellular repair.

Professional Effectiveness



Cold laser treatment has actually shown its professional efficacy in various clinical applications, showcasing its performance in advertising recovery and decreasing recovery times. This non-invasive treatment has actually been located advantageous in speeding up tissue repair, decreasing swelling, and eliminating discomfort. Research has shown that cold laser treatment can improve the healing procedure by advertising the manufacturing of adenosine triphosphate (ATP) in cells, which is essential for cellular function and regrowth.

In medical researches, cold laser therapy has confirmed to be reliable in dealing with conditions such as tendonitis, arthritis, carpal tunnel syndrome, and sporting activities injuries. Individuals undergoing cold laser therapy have actually reported considerable discomfort reduction, improved variety of activity, and much faster healing contrasted to typical treatments.

The targeted application of low-level laser light penetrates deep into cells, stimulating organic processes at a cellular degree without causing any type of pain or adverse effects.
